v1.8 | 17.03.2026

This update introduces a full Google Drive workspace inside Team Boards, with improved file management, clearer navigation, safer renaming, and key fixes to deliver a more reliable and organized Drive experience.

Team Board Drive
Team Boards now include a dedicated :google:
Google Drive workspace
with a full file manager experience. Instead of a limited inline view, Drive now has its own page where your team can browse board files and folders in a cleaner, more organized way.
File Management
You can now manage Drive content directly inside the board’s Drive area. This includes browsing folders, opening files, uploading new files, creating folders, renaming items, and deleting files or folders when needed. The new view also makes navigation easier with a clearer structure for moving through nested folders.
Drive Experience Improvements
The Drive area has been improved to feel more like a proper workspace rather than a simple attachment browser. Files and folders are displayed more clearly, actions are easier to access, and the overall layout is better suited for teams who use Google Drive as part of their day-to-day board workflow.
Safer File Renaming
File renaming is now safer and more controlled. When you rename a file, only the file name itself can be edited, while the original extension stays locked.
For example, a PDF can be renamed, but
.pdf
cannot be changed by mistake.
Fixes
We fixed an issue where newly created folders could appear twice, including once as if they were regular files. Folder and file listings are now handled correctly so each item appears only once in the right place. We also fixed the item action menu so it displays properly above the Drive content instead of being hidden underneath other elements.
